Shower window installation services involve the careful placement of windows in bathroom showers to enhance natural light, ventilation, and privacy. These installations typically include selecting the right window style, measuring for proper fit, and ensuring the window is properly sealed to prevent water infiltration. Professional contractors can handle different types of shower windows, such as frosted glass, textured panes, or operable designs that can be opened for airflow. Proper installation not only improves the shower space’s functionality but also adds aesthetic appeal, making the bathroom more comfortable and inviting.

One of the main problems that shower window installation addresses is excess moisture and poor ventilation in bathrooms. Without adequate airflow, bathrooms can develop issues like mold, mildew, and lingering odors. A well-installed shower window allows moisture to escape and fresh air to circulate, reducing the risk of these problems. Additionally, installing a window can provide natural light, decreasing the need for artificial lighting during the day. This combination of improved ventilation and lighting can make a significant difference in maintaining a healthier, more pleasant bathroom environment.

The overview below groups typical Shower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Many routine shower window repairs or replacements typically cost between $250 and $600. Most projects in this range involve replacing a single window or repairing minor damage. Larger, more complex repairs can exceed this range but are less common.

Standard Window Replacement - Replacing an existing shower window with a new, standard-sized unit usually falls between $600 and $1,200. Many local contractors handle these projects within this range, depending on materials and installation specifics.

Full Shower Window Installation - Complete installation of new shower windows, especially in larger or custom bathrooms, can range from $1,200 to $3,000. Projects in this tier are more involved and may include custom framing or specialty glass.

High-End or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ate shower window installations, such as custom designs or multiple windows, can reach $5,000 or more. These projects are less frequent and typically involve premium materials or detailed craftsmanship.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of shower windows do local contractors install? Local contractors typically install a variety of shower windows, including frosted, textured, and clear glass options, to suit different privacy and aesthetic preferences.

Can local service providers handle custom-sized shower windows? Yes, many local contractors can measure and install custom-sized shower windows to fit specific space requirements and design preferences.

What materials are commonly used for shower windows? Common materials include tempered glass for safety, as well as framed or frameless designs made from aluminum, vinyl, or other durable materials.

Are there options for enhancing privacy with shower windows? Yes, local pros can recommend and install privacy features such as frosted glass, decorative films, or textured glass to ensure privacy during showers.

What should be considered when choosing a shower window? Factors include the window’s size, material, privacy level, ventilation options, and compatibility with the existing bathroom design, which local contractors can advise on.
